In an unprecedented move, the International Criminal Court (ICC) ordered its prosecutor to reopen an already closed investigation into crimes allegedly committed by the Israeli navy when boarding the Mavi Marmara, a ship participating in the 2010 blockade-busting flotilla to Gaza. The ICC’s decision, writes Avi Bell, disregards both international law and the facts of the case:
